Isola Vicentina: A Snapshot of Urban Livability in the Veneto Region
Nestled in the picturesque province of Vicenza within Italy's vibrant Veneto region, Isola Vicentina is a charming small town boasting a population of approximately 9,319 residents. Known for its rich history and serene landscapes, this comune offers an intriguing balance of traditional charm and modern urban livability elements.
